Rewards App Fetch to Debut Credit Card with Imprint, Amex
by Kyle Burbank
Fetch is set to roll out a new credit card in partnership with Imprint. About the Fetch American Express Card: This week, the rewards app Fetch revealed plans to introduce its first U.S. credit card. Dubbed the Fetch American Express Card, the new offering will be powered by Imprint and utilize the Amex payment network. First Electronic Bank will issue the product. Chase Reportedly Nearing Deal to Acquire Apple Card Program
by Kyle Burbank
As Apple continues to seek a new partner for its popular Apple Card, a new report suggests that JPMorgan Chase could be nearing a deal to step into the role. About Chase's Potential Apple Card Takeover: According to the Wall Street Journal, Chase is in "advanced talks" to acquire Apple's credit card program from current issuer Goldman Sachs.
